Editorial Summary
John from Envelope Travel provides a tour of cabin 15154 on the Norwegian Prima, which is a standard balcony stateroom located on deck 15. The video begins with a view of Reykjavik, Iceland, from the spacious balcony during the ship's inaugural cruise. The creator examines the interior layout, noting an Italian style design that lacks traditional bed skirts, which allows for visible luggage storage underneath the bed. The room features various charging options including USB and USB-C ports located on the nightstands, along with both US and European style plugs. Storage solutions include a small couch, a versatile footstool, and a wardrobe area with space for longer items. The creator points out that the dresser area utilizes basket style drawers rather than standard dressers and notes that the cabinet doors can occasionally catch hanging clothes. The tour concludes with a look at the sizable bathroom, which includes a walk-in shower, shelving units, and provided toiletries. The creator expresses excitement about being on board the new ship and promises a full ship tour in a future video.
